Esmé Partridge

Esmé is a Researcher at Theos. She joined in November 2025 having previously worked in Parliament and for think tanks, authoring the report ‘Restoring the Value of Parishes: The Foundations of Welfare, Community and Spiritual Belonging in England’ (Civitas, 2024) among other publications. Esmé holds an MPhil in the Philosophy of Religion from the University of Cambridge and a BA in the Study of Religions from SOAS, University of London. She is also a Civic Future Fellow.
